Transaction 89e03cc19c7fbe5bfeab8442d87ab0107e836a635259400f5bf1dcbdac22e0c6
1 Input
1 Output
-
89e03cc19c7fbe5bfeab8442d87ab0107e836a635259400f5bf1dcbdac22e0c6:0
- value
- 2277607
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1ec7a82de5c05aee2e0f68e4d1f0a151325b1af OP_EQUAL
- address
- 3HunpKHbtDeGoJVdcBQ8HbsMeLthU4VSv7